Position Description

The Software Engineer develops, maintains, and enhances complex and diverse software systems (e.g., processing‑intensive analytics, novel algorithm development, manipulation of extremely large data sets, real‑time systems, and business management information systems) based upon documented requirements. Works individually or as part of a team. Reviews and tests software components for adherence to the design requirements and documents test results. Resolves software problem reports. Utilizes software development and software design methodologies appropriate to the development environment. Provides specific input to the software components of system design to include hardware/software trade‑offs, software reuse, use of COTS/GOTS in place of new development, and requirements analysis and synthesis from system level to individual software components.

Level 0
  • Analyze user requirements to derive software design and performance requirements
  • Design and code new software or modify existing software to add new features
  • Debug existing software and correct defects
  • Integrate existing software into new or modified systems or operating environments
  • Develop simple data queries for existing or proposed databases or data repositories
  • Make recommendations for improving documentation and software development process standards
Level 1
  • Develop or implement algorithms to meet or exceed system performance and functional standards
  • Assist with developing and executing test procedures for software components
  • Write or review software and system documentation
  • Develop software solutions by analyzing system performance standards, conferring with users or system engineers; analyzing systems flow, data usage and work processes; and investigating problem areas
  • Serve as team lead at the level appropriate to the software development process being used on any particular project
  • Modify existing software to correct errors, to adapt to new hardware, or to improve its performance
  • Design, develop and modify software systems, using scientific analysis and mathematical models to predict and measure outcome and consequences of design
  • Design or implement complex database or data repository interfaces/queries
Level 2
  • Oversee one or more software development teams and ensure the work is completed in accordance with the constraints of the software development process being used on any particular project
  • Design or implement complex algorithms requiring adherence to strict timing, system resource, or interface constraints
  • Perform quality control on team products
  • Confer with system engineers and hardware engineers to derive software requirements and to obtain information on project limitations and capabilities, performance requirements and interfaces
  • Coordinate software system installation and monitor equipment functioning to ensure operational specifications are met
  • Implement recommendations for improving documentation and software development process standards
Level 3
  • Serve as the technical lead of multiple software development teams
  • Select the software development process in coordination with the customer and system engineering
  • Recommend new technologies and processes for complex software projects
  • Ensure quality control of all developed and modified software
  • Delegate programming and testing responsibilities to one or more teams and monitor their performance
